Are you ready to get rokken with Dokken on Sept. 25? That's when the veteran hard rock band will drop its 11th studio album 'Broken Bones' via Frontiers Records.

The 11-track album will be released in a pair of configurations: a standard CD for regular fans and a limited edition digipak with a bonus DVD, which includes a "Making Of" documentary, which is a "must own" for the diehard Dokkenites! The first single from 'Broken Bones' is 'Empire,' which sounds like vintage Dokken, combining squalling riffs with melodic tendencies.

Frontman Don Dokken pulled double duty with 'Broken Bones,' serving as the producer. The multitasking vocalist was quick to point out that Dokken have remained vital three decades into their career, despite never having had a chart-topping single, by doing things the old fashioned way and that's by capturing fans via touring!

"We've never had a No. 1 hit," he said in a statement. "We've just kept touring winning fans over one by one." That formula has worked for the band so why divert from the path?

'Broken Bones' Track Listing:

1. 'Empire'
2. 'Broken Bones'
3. 'Best of Me'
4. 'Blind'
5. 'Waterfall'
6. 'Victim of the Crime'
7. 'Burning Tears'
8. 'Today'
9. 'For the Last Time'
10. 'Fade Away'
11. 'Tonight'
